So I know how to resize images, etc.
I am pretty good with photoshop, etc.
However I have an image set to the exact dimensions of my Incredible.
Yet, it still wants to crop the image because when you swipe screens it scrolls the image.

Is there any way to have a static image for every background?
I thought turning off background animations would correct this but it doesn't.

I'm pretty sure the Droid Incredinbles wallpaper needs to be 960x800 in order to see the full resolution. You'll still have to use the crop box when you assign the wallpaper but just simply stretch it out over the entire image and it will work fine.

re-size the original image to only 800 pixels tall then paste it on to a 960x800 solid color background of your choice (like black)

but it'll still 'scroll' left and right unless you use something like Launcher Pro that disables that option
